Practice Suggestions

To effectively overcome the identified challenges, string by string practice is essential. For measure 4, isolate the palm muting sections by playing them slowly, ensuring that each note rings clearly without unwanted noise. Gradually increase the speed while maintaining clarity.

During measure 11, divide the triplet sections into smaller phrases. Start by practicing each triplet slowly, focusing on alternate picking (D for down-sweep and U for up-sweep), and gradually merge them into full phrases. This will cultivate coordination between both hands and ensure tighter synchronization.

Furthermore, incorporate a metronome during practice sessions to maintain steady temporal control throughout the piece.
